Job description

Right across infrastructure, there’s a requirement to not only maintain, but also renew and reimagine. Whatever stage you’re at in your career, with us you’ll have an opportunity to grow and develop. Delivering essential infrastructure services for life, while being safety first and client and customer centric in a friendly, fun and respectful environment where you are encouraged to thrive.

Where will you be working?

We help our clients safeguard the water supply, improve environmental performance and manage demand for future generations. We enhance and extend asset life, ensuring compliance with water quality and environmental standards. We’re problem solvers with over 140 years of combined experience in engineering and infrastructure.

This role will be within our water and wastewater capital project delivery team. Our teams deliver large-scale capital programmes aimed at keeping water infrastructure resilient for the long-term while protecting the environment.

What will you be doing?
  • Undertake setting out and surveying activities for clean water trunk main installations and associated infrastructure.
  • Interpret construction drawings, specifications, and technical documentation.
  • Manage and monitor construction activities to ensure compliance with design requirements and Thames Water standards.
  • Coordinate trenching, pipe laying, thrust boring, directional drilling, valve installations, washouts, air valves, and associated civil works.
  • Review and resolve site engineering issues in collaboration with design teams and project management.
  • Support commissioning, pressure testing, chlorination, sampling, and network integration activities
  • Ensure all works meet Thames Water quality standards and project specifications.
  • Maintain accurate site records, quality documentation, inspection and test plans (ITPs), and as-built information.
  • Coordinate material inspections and verify compliance with approved specifications.
  • Manage non-conformance reporting and corrective actions where required.
  • Promote a strong safety culture and ensure compliance with company and client health and safety procedures.
  • Ensure works are carried out in accordance with CDM Regulations, Water Industry standards, and site-specific risk assessments.
  • Review and implement RAMS (Risk Assessments and Method Statements).
  • Conduct site inspections, audits, and toolbox talks.
  • Ensure environmental controls are maintained to minimise impacts on customers, watercourses, and local communities.
